Unique Identification Authority of India (UIDAI) today appealed people to register or update their mobile numbers in Aadhaar for easy access of various government services online.

"People can avail various government services online from the comfort of their home or from wherever they are in a hassle-free manner by using their Aadhaar - the unique and non-repudiable identifier," UIDAI CEO Ajay Bhushan Pandey said in a statement.

"Aadhaar-based OTP (one-time password) identification empowers residents to avail these services online hassle-free and conveniently," he said.

Those who did not register their mobile number during Aadhaar enrolment should get it registered or update it to have better communications and effortless access to government services, the statement said.
